Make sure your home appears occupied. You could purchase timers which make lights and TV’s, as well as other devices, power on or off at varying intervals. This way it will always look as if someone is home, even when you are away. This is great for keeping a home safer from burglaries.

Home security systems have different kinds of features to just being noise alarms. Many systems sound an alert you whenever anyone has entered your home. This is a valuable safety feature for parents that have small children so that they know when their child has exited the home.

It can be a good idea to only leave one ringer on in your home when you are away. If a burglar keeps hearing your phone ring, they’ll know the home is not occupied, making it more likely for a break-in to occur.

No matter how soon you plan to return home, you should lock your doors. It may be shocking, but many home invasions and burglaries occur by intruders walking through the front door that was left open. It doesn’t take long for a thief to steal thousands of dollars worth of stuff.

Once you’ve moved to a new house, make it a priority to replace all locks. Regardless of how you feel about the sellers, you never know someone’s true intentions. Besides, other tenants or owners might have copies of the key if the previous owners did not change the locks.

Whenever you sign with a home-security company, it is important that you thoroughly read the contract. They sometimes have hidden costs if you let go of them prior to the contract expiring. You should avoid such expenses if you can, so make yourself aware.

Don’t forget about the skylights when doing a security sweep for your home.Skylights are nice to bring extra light into your house, but unfortunately they also often provide a way for a burglar to enter. Be certain that the skylights in your home can be locked securely.

Keep safety at the forefront when landscaping your property. Doors and windows should not be obstructed by trees, plants or shrubs. This way, no one can hide there if they are attempting to break into your house. This will give your home additional safety.

Keep valuables that are irreplaceable secure. Items such as family photos, passports, legal documents, expensive jewelry and financial records need to be placed at a secure location. Purchase a safe with a lock to store all of these items. You can also rent out a safety deposit box.

Replace your doors with some that are solid wood or metal. Doors made of metal or wood are much sturdier than those that aren’t. A would-be intruder will have much more trouble getting through one of these than a hollow door. It shouldn’t be too costly to replace your exterior doors, so go do it.

Make friends with a talkative neighbor who is home a lot. If there are people lurking around your home that look suspicious, this busybody may be the first to notice. When you’re on good terms with them, you are more likely to receive word of any unusual activity.

Regularly clean carbon monoxide and smoke detectors. Lint and dust could build up in these and could interfere with them. If they won’t go off because of dust, these detectors cannot protect your home.

A home alarm might be a good investment if police are notified when it sounds.The only way to ensure this is to use a centrally monitored alarm so that calls the police always show up if it is triggered. You don’t want to have to rely on just your neighbors to call them.

When you open the door to a stranger, you open it also to danger. If a stranger knocks on your door, do not open the door to help them. If they need a phone, tell them you will make the call for them. If someone on your doorstep has you feeling wary, simply call the police to deal with them.
